Output 5bb3b960b6828ec75633465fab325a271b1658bf7b6fe70ac200ab5b41c49d59:1

value
150899
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8f40c983a27d9443f0c1476e9d2b07c0f0e8e3846d62747544e204ea3a81f66d
address
bc1p3aqvnqaz0k2y8uxpgahf62c8crcw3cuyd438ga2yugzw5w5p7ekspp2yp8
transaction
5bb3b960b6828ec75633465fab325a271b1658bf7b6fe70ac200ab5b41c49d59
confirmations
57004
spent
true